研究目的
To manufacture functionally gradient materials (FGM) with composition variation from a copper alloy to a soda-lime glass using a proprietary nozzle-based multi-material selective laser melting (MMSLM) system and to examine the mechanical properties of the FGM.
研究成果
The bonding mechanism of metal and glass was that melted glass penetrated into the CMC phase, which played a role to anchor the glass. Both horizontal gradient and vertical gradient structures were achieved. The weakest part of the FGM structure occurred at the interface between transition phase and the CMC, which was also the interface between the ductile and brittle phases.
研究不足
The thickness of the glass part was limited, which should be improved by further research. The oxide layer between materials may be much thinner, probably in the nano scale, which requires further investigation.
1:Experimental Design and Method Selection:
A new, in situ powder mixing system was developed to mix two different powders (Cu10Sn copper-alloy and soda-lime glass) at selective ratios. The mixed powders were dispensed with an ultrasonic vibration powder feeding system. Laser parameters for different powder mixing ratios were optimized.
2:Sample Selection and Data Sources:
Cu10Sn copper-alloy spherical powders and spherical soda-lime powders were used. Different ratios of glass powders were prepared from 5 wt.% to 65 wt.% of the mixture.
3:List of Experimental Equipment and Materials:
A 500 W ytterbium single-mode, continuous wave (CW) fibre laser, an Intelli SCAN x-y galvo, and an ultrasonic vibration powder feeding system were used. Powders were Cu10Sn copper-alloy and soda-lime glass.
4:Experimental Procedures and Operational Workflow:
Powders were mixed and dispensed onto the work platform. The laser selectively scanned the powder layer to melt powders. The process was repeated layer by layer until the 3D printed part was completed.
5:Data Analysis Methods:
Microstructural analysis was carried out using an SEM and optical microscopy. Mechanical properties were examined through indentation, tensile, and shear tests.
